Germany Automated Western Blotter Market By Application

The Germany Automated Western Blotter Market is currently experiencing robust growth, driven by technological advancements and increasing demand for precise protein analysis in biomedical research and clinical diagnostics. Valued at approximately USD 150 million in 2023, the market is projected to expand at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 7% over the next five years. This growth is primarily fueled by the rising prevalence of chronic diseases, the need for high-throughput screening, and the increasing adoption of automation to enhance laboratory efficiency and reproducibility.

Major Application Segments of the Germany Automated Western Blotter Market

1. Clinical Diagnostics

Clinical diagnostics represent the largest application segment within the Germany Automated Western Blotter Market, accounting for approximately 45% of the total market share in 2023. The demand for automated Western blotting in this sector is driven by the need for highly accurate, reproducible, and rapid diagnostic tests for infectious diseases, autoimmune disorders, and cancer biomarkers. Automated systems enable laboratories to perform complex protein analyses with minimal manual intervention, reducing turnaround times and minimizing human error.

Industry adoption trends indicate a growing preference for integrated automation platforms that streamline workflows and ensure compliance with regulatory standards such as CE marking and IVDR. Major end-use industries include hospitals, diagnostic laboratories, and specialized clinics. The future outlook remains optimistic, with emerging trends focusing on multiplexing capabilities, integration with digital health records, and the development of point-of-care testing devices. As personalized medicine gains traction, the demand for precise protein detection in clinical settings is expected to surge, further propelling this segment’s growth.

2. Pharmaceutical and Biotech Research

The pharmaceutical and biotech research sector constitutes a significant application segment, contributing approximately 30% of the market share. Automated Western blotting is extensively used for target validation, biomarker discovery, and drug development processes. The high sensitivity and specificity offered by automated systems facilitate detailed protein profiling, which is crucial for understanding disease mechanisms and developing targeted therapies.

Demand drivers include increased R&D investments, collaborations between academia and industry, and the need for high-throughput screening methods. Adoption trends show a shift towards fully automated platforms that integrate with other laboratory information management systems (LIMS), enabling seamless data management. Major end-use industries encompass pharmaceutical companies, contract research organizations (CROs), and biotech firms. Future growth opportunities lie in the integration of automation with artificial intelligence (AI) for data analysis and the development of miniaturized platforms suitable for early-stage research and personalized medicine applications.
